Tiger is a powerful H.265 (HEVC) / H.264 (AVC) fully ruggedized video encoder and streaming platform that is designed to support video transmission needs in harsh field environments.
With bypass video outputs, low latency encoding, and low power consumption, Tiger is non-intrusive and yet feature-rich.
Tiger is capable of capturing single 3G-SDI or HD-SDI or Composite video input simultaneously and encoding using video encoding standards) H.265 (HEVC) or H.264 (MPEG-4 AVC standard.
It can create up to 3 encoded video streams per input.
The encoding parameters are highly configurable with support for main (H.265/H.264), baseline & high profiles (H.264) with many bitrate configurations (54 Kbps to 20 Mbps; Constant & Variable rate control).
All streams are then sent out from the 1Gbps Ethernet output.
The Tiger design is easily customizable for different types of video input formats such as DVI and HDMI.
KLV (Key-Length-Value) metadata insertion is supported via RS-232 or Ethernet. KLV is “muxed” into the MPEG-2 TS container. The resulting MPEG-2 TS video is then streamed out over UDP with optional RTP support headers. This standardization ensures interoperability with the decoders and displays retrieving the encoded stream.

Tiger is ruggedized to survive harsh environments (shock, vibration, humidity, dust, sand) and temperatures from -20°C to 70°C (MIL-STD-810G & IP67) as well as fully tested with 461 specifications in an international certified lab.
It comes with dedicated mounting holes for mounting on to racks.
Its rugged small form factor design makes it easy to use and integrate into any system design and meets the SWaP (size, weight & power) requirements for all of the vertical markets.
In the default configuration, the product accepts single high definition video inputs in 3G-SDI, HD-SDI or Composite format through BNC connectors. Audio, 1Gbps Ethernet & RS-232 are routed over a 14-pin rugged circular MIL spec connector.
Other video input formats and connector types are possible with small modifications to the design even for low volume opportunities.
Control of encoding settings and retrieval of the Tiger health information are all performed using web GUI(i.E, Chrome and others) and API built around SNMPv2 for simple and secure communication.
This API is built for easy integration into existing customer applications.
Several sample applications are provided to ensure prompt integration into a working system. Configuration can also be done using the built in web server GUI which is accessed from a browser on a networked device.
This GUI can be used to configure all encoding and network settings, update the device, save settings, and retrieve status information. Support for uploading of XML configuration files allow for quick and easy configuration of deployable units.
